engagement

Nouns

  • (n) a hostile meeting of opposing military forces in the course of a war
    • Grant won a decisive victory in the battle of Chickamauga
    • he lost his romantic ideas about war when he got into a real engagement
    battle, fight, conflict,
  • (n) a meeting arranged in advance
    • she asked how to avoid kissing at the end of a date
    appointment, date,
  • (n) a mutual promise to marry betrothal, troth,
  • (n) the act of giving someone a job employment,
  • (n) employment for performers or performing groups that lasts for a limited period of time
    • the play had bookings throughout the summer
    booking,
  • (n) contact by fitting together
    • the engagement of the clutch
    • the meshing of gears
    interlocking, meshing, mesh,
  • (n) the act of sharing in the activities of a group
    • the teacher tried to increase his students' engagement in class activities
    involvement, participation, involution,
